Streaming Calendar: 37 Movies And Shows To Watch Out For In June 2020

From new films by Anurag Kashyap and Spike Lee to Shoojit Sircar's Gulabo Sitabo, here are our picks of what’s releasing in June across Netflix, Amazon Prime Video, Disney+ Hotstar, ZEE5 and more
Streaming Calendar: 37 Movies And Shows To Watch Out For In June 2020

In the age of Coronavirus quarantines, lockdowns and self-isolation, many more of us are relying on streaming platforms in search of distraction, escape and just plain entertainment. Luckily June certainly doesn't look to disappoint with an exciting new set of streaming releases offering a wide range of stories. From a new Netflix original film from Anurag Kashyap, to Shoojit Sircar's Gulabo Sitabo to the Spike Lee's streaming debut, here are our picks of what's releasing this month across platforms.

Netflix

Fuller House: The Farewell Season 

When: June 2nd

The reboot of the beloved show comes to an end with its final season as the Tanner gang come back together for one last hurrah. When Jimmy and Steph bring their new baby home, they dive headfirst into the world of parenting. Luckily, they've got a houseful of hands to help.

Spelling The Dream

When: June 3rd

Following four hopeful competitors' journeys, this documentary explores the trend of Indian-Americans ruling the Scripps National Spelling Bee since 1999 for the past 12 years straight with perspectives from CNN's Dr. Sanjay Gupta and Fareed Zakaria, comedian Hari Kondabolu and more.

Choked

When: June 5th 

After directing two shorts and a series, it was only a matter of time before Anurag Kashyap made his feature film debut on Netflix. His latest stars Saiyami Kher and Roshan Mathew in a story about a bank employee weighed down by her jobless husband's debts who finds a secret source of seemingly unlimited cash in her home.

13 Reasons Why: Final Season

When: June 5th

The final season of the hit teen drama sees Liberty High School's Senior Class prepare for graduation. But before they can say goodbye, the crew of friends will have to band together one last time to keep a dangerous secret buried  and face final, heartbreaking choices that might alter their lives forever.

Queer Eye: Season 5

When: June 5th

The Fab Five head to historic Philadelphia to make over a new cast of everyday heroes, from a hardworking DJ to a struggling dog groomer.

The Last Days Of American Crime

When: June 5th

A bank robber joins a plot to commit one final, historic heist before the government turns on a mind-altering signal that will end all criminal behaviour in this futuristic action flick starring Edgar Ramirez.

Da 5 Bloods

When: June 12th 

The latest from the Oscar-winning Spike Lee sees him team up with Chadwick Boseman in a story of four African American veterans who return to Vietnam decades after the war to find their squad leader's remains — and a stash of buried gold.

F Is For Family Season 4

When: June 12th 

Bill Burr's animated adult comedy is back for more dysfunction and laughs. While Frank deals with an unwelcome visit from his estranged father, Sue pursues New Age pregnancy support, and the Murphy kids try out new personas.

The Politician Season 2

When: June 19th 

Ryan Murphy's dark comedy series on the state of modern politics returns to further the story of Payton Hobart (Ben Platt), a wealthy student from Santa Barbara, California, who has known since age seven that he's going to be the president of the United States. But first he'll have to navigate the most treacherous political landscape of all — high school.

Lost Bullet

When: June 19th 

A French thriller from director Guillaume Pierret which follows a mechanical wiz is mistakenly charged with murder. The only proof of his innocence is a bullet lodged in a missing car.

Dark Season 3

When: June 27th 

One of Netflix's most beloved international hits, the twisty German sci-fi thriller returns for its third season. The final cycle is about to begin, but will the loop finally be broken? Find out on June 27th.

El Presidente

When: June 5th 

It appears Amazon Prime Video is looking to emulate Netflix's focus on global content with El Presidente – a Spanish true crime drama series that explores the real-life conspiracy underlying the beginning of the 2015 FIFA Gate corruption scandal.

Gine Brillon: The Floor Is Lava

When: June 5th 

Comedian Gina Brillon brings the laugh in her new special which sees her commenting on racism, dating, married life and beyond.

7500

When: June 19th 

Joseph Gordon Levitt stars in a German hijack drama about a young American co-pilot on a flight from Berlin to Paris whose flight is hijacked by terrorists.

LOL: Last One Laughing Australia: Season 1

When: June 19th

We've all loved watching Australians get their master-chef on, now watch them make us laugh in this competitive comedy reality show – hosted by the inimitable Rebel Wilson – which follows ten professional comedians locked together in a house tasked with making all of the other comedians laugh while keeping a straight face themselves.

Rasbhari

When: June 19th

The latest Amazon Indian Original series stars Swara Bhaskar as an English teacher whose life gets difficult after one of her students falls in love with her.

Penguin

When: June 19th

From producer Karthik Subbaraj comes a Tamil film starring Keerthy Suresh (Mahanati). It is the next big film to go to direct to streaming. Rumoured to be a thriller, not much is known about the film thus far aside from the exciting names attached.

Bad Boys For Life

When: June 21st

The highly anticipated third instalment of the action franchise starring Will Smith and Martin Lawrence finally makes its way to the small screen. 17 years on, Mike and Marcus are back for more ass-kicking, shootouts and car chases.

Law 

When: June 26th 

Written and directed by Raghu Samarth, the direct to digital Kannada release stars Ragini Chandran, Siri Prahlad and Mukhyamantri Chandru.

Motherless Brooklyn

When: June 26th

Edward Norton turns writer and director in a movie about a lonely private detective living with Tourette Syndrome who ventures to solve the murder of his mentor and only friend, Frank Minna (Bruce Willis).

Jojo Rabbit

When: June 2nd

Acclaimed writer-director Taika Waititi brings his signature humour and pathos to Jojo Rabbit, a World War II satire that follows a lonely German boy and his imaginary best friend – Hitler – whose world view is turned upside down when he discovers his single mother is hiding a young Jewish girl in their attic.

Trackers

When: June 6th 

Based on Deon Meyer's bestselling novel, this new action-packed thriller follows a violent conspiracy and an international terrorist plot that collide in Cape Town, South Africa.

I May Destroy You 

When: June 8th 

A fearless and provocative new series exploring the question of sexual consent through Arabella, a witty up-and-coming writer whose life changes irreversibly when she's sexually assaulted in a nightclub.

Terminator: Dark Fate

When: June 16th

The latest attempt to reboot the Terminator franchise comes from Deadpool director Tim Miller and sees the original cast reunite. Decades after Sarah Connor prevented Judgment Day, a lethal new Terminator is sent to eliminate the future leader of the resistance.

Ford Vs Ferrari 

When: June 30th 

Academy Award Winners Matt Damon and Christian Bale star in exhilarating true story of visionary American car designer Carroll Shelby (Damon) and fearless British-born driver Ken Miles (Bale), who together built a revolutionary race car for the Ford Motor Company to take on the dominating Enzo Ferrari in 1966.

I'll Be Gone In The Dark

When: June 29th 

A six-part documentary series based on the book of the same name, I'll Be Gone In The Dark explores writer Michelle McNamara's (the late wife of comedian Patton Oswalt) investigation into the violent predator she dubbed "The Golden State Killer", who terrorised California in the 70s and 80s and is responsible for 50 home-invasion rapes and 12 murders.

Perry Mason 

When: June 22nd

Based on characters created by author Erle Stanley Gardner, this drama series follows the origins of American fiction's most legendary criminal defence lawyer, Perry Mason. When the case of the decade breaks down his door, Mason's relentless pursuit of the truth reveals a fractured city and just maybe, a pathway to redemption for himself.

Sony LIV

Your Honour 

When: TBC

Adapted from the Israeli series Kvodo, Your Honour is a dark thriller starring Jimmy Sheirgill, Mita Vashisht, Varun Badola and more.

Apple TV

Dear…

When: June 5th 

One person's story can change the world. From Emmy-winning filmmaker R.J. Cutler, Dear… profiles game-changing icons such as Spike Lee, Oprah and Sesame Street's Big Bird  and the people whose lives they've inspired using letters that fans have written to them.

Dads

When: June 19th 

Making her feature directorial debut, Bryce Dallas Howard teams up with her father, Ron Howard, to explore contemporary fatherhood through anecdotes and wisdom from famous funnymen such as Will Smith, Jimmy Fallon, Neil Patrick Harris, and more.

ALTBalaji & ZEE5

Kehne Ko Humsafar Hai Season 3

When: June 6th 

Get ready to meet this gloriously dysfunctional family again as the the romantic drama starring Ronit Roy and Mona Singh returns.

ZEE5

Chintu Ka Birthday

When: June 5th 

Produced by comedy group AIB, Chintu Ka Birthday is a drama set in Iraq about a family who find themselves trapped by American soldiers. From directors Satyanshu and Devanshu Singh, the film offers an exciting cast including Vinay Pathak and Tillotama Shome.

The Casino

When: June 12th 

The Hindi original series follows Vicky – the reluctant heir to a billion-dollar casino who's emotionally trapped by his father's manipulative mistress Rehana who must find a way to overthrow her and claim his inheritance.

Never Kiss Your Best Friend – Lockdown Special

When: June 14th 

Never Kiss Your Best Friend is the latest series to attempt to keep the magic going from within the confines of lockdown, this time with a new male lead in place of Nakuul Mehta. To resurrect her image as a best-selling romance writer, Tanie (Anya Singh) fakes an online relationship with her first 'guy best friend turned boyfriend', only to find herself falling in love with him all over again.

Amrutham Dhivitheeyam

When: June 25th 

A sequel to the popular Telugu sitcom Amrutham, Amrutham Dhvitheeyam is an oddball comedy starring Harsha Vardhan, L B Sriram, Vasu, and Sivannarayana.

Lalbazaar

When: June 19th 

A Bengali crime drama starring Kaushik Sen, Sabyasachi Chakraborty and Sauraseni Maitra which follows the lives of Kolkata's Police officers as they deal with the complex world of crime.
